The physical properties of Ambroxide contribute significantly to its handling and application. It typically presents as a white powder, with a melting point in the range of 74-76 °C. This solid form makes it convenient for storage, transportation, and precise dosing in various formulations. While the direct scent of the pure product might be subtle, upon dilution and exposure to air, Ambroxane 99% cosmetic raw material develops its signature soft, mellow, and beautiful ambergris fragrance. This characteristic is crucial for perfumers who often employ a 'maturation' process to fully unlock the scent's potential.
Chemically, Ambroxide exhibits properties that ensure its efficacy and stability. Its boiling point is around 273.9±8.0 °C, and it has a density of 0.939. The optical activity, measured as [α]20/D 29°, c = 1 in toluen, indicates its specific stereochemical configuration, which is vital for its olfactory profile. The application spectrum for Ambroxide perfume ingredient is remarkably wide. It is a cornerstone in the creation of fine fragrances, providing a warm, woody, and ambery base note that enhances longevity and complexity. Beyond haute couture perfumery, its non-allergenic nature makes it an excellent choice for cosmetic raw materials for flavor and scent in products such as soaps, shampoos, lotions, and creams. In addition to personal care, Ambroxide also finds application in other sectors, including as a tobacco flavouring agent, and can be used in incense.
